The Pain Management Jobs Center

As an award-winning online career center, MDLinx Career Center is one of the best resources available for medical professionals seeking available jobs in the pain management field. Whether you are a physician, nurse practitioner, physician assistant, or other clinician, seeking pain management careers on this site enables to search quickly and confidently through a comprehensive collection of the most recent and compatible job openings that match their specifications. MDLinx provides a host of tools aiding in career search that will help you find the Pain Management Job that is best for you and your career needs.


Using the Job Search tab to begin, conveniently browse through postings for available pain management jobs throughout the country, or in your designated area. Temporary, permanent, part-time or full-time positions are listed as requested. To start, just type in the keywords describing the type of medical job you desire, the area you where you wish to live and work, and select the title of the profession you are searching for from the drop box.


For example: Keyword: Physician, Area: zip code 32211, Medical Profession: Pain Management.


From here, all Pain Management Careers for physicians available in the specified area will be displayed on the page.


To make future related searches more simplified, use the 'Job Tools' tab to save and manage your search and application history. Here you can save your preferences and receive alerts for related job openings in pain management, before searching through more listings. You can also track your previous applications and their progress, or save jobs for future applications if you need more time to consider the details of the position.


The 'CV Profile' tab allows you to upload your Curriculum Vitae directly to your profile. This will grant potential employers and recruiters the option to review your credentials and contact you specifically based on the details on your CV, as soon as positions become available in your area and desired field of pain management. By uploading your CV, this will create a faster, more straightforward opportunity for clients to contact exactly the candidate they seek. If needed, you may also submit your CV directly to MDLinx and the admin team can take care of the details and post your CV for you.


For helpful tips and guidance while looking for a career in Pain Management, as well as other medical professions, use the 'Career Articles' tab. Here you will find useful publications and articles guiding you through the job search process, appropriate interview questions and answers, tips for constructing a relevant and detailed CV, and how to mediate the terms of your employment contract and salary.


If needed, the 'Career Fairs' tab will aid in locating career fairs in your desired area that are hiring for pain management jobs that fit your career needs and goals. You can meet up with fellow physicians in the pain management field, as well as employers seeking to hire clinicians to their pain management practices. Attending these events can give you the chance to meet and greet these potential co-workers and employers, and also network to learn more about the companies where you may want to apply for employment.
